Situational Awareness: Active Shooter Seminar
Presented by Santa Fe Springs Policing Team
 
Active shooter situations are unpredictable and evolve quickly. Because active shooter situations are often over within 10 to 15 minutes, before law enforcement arrives on the scene, individuals must be prepared both mentally and physically to deal with an active shooter situation.

The Situational Awareness Active Shooter Seminar provides a variety of no cost resources to the public to enhance preparedness and response to an active shooter incident. The goal of the seminar is to ensure awareness of actions that can be taken before, during, and after an incident.
 
Participates will learn:
  • Actions for responding to such situations.
  • What to do if the shooter is inside the building.
  • What to do if the shooter comes into the room or office.
